Home Value Estimator For Morris, MN

There are currently 1,852 real estate properties in Morris, MN, with a median automated valuation model (AVM) price of $201,802.00. What is an AVM? It is a smart computer program that analyzes and predicts the approximate value of a home, property or land in Morris, MN, based on current market trends, comparable real estate sales nearby, historical data and, of course, property features, among other variables. These automated home estimates are often very helpful, providing buyers and sellers with a better idea of a home’s value ahead of the negotiation process. Cost Of Living In Morris, MN

So, about how much do homes cost in Morris? The most recent median value of resident-owned homes in Morris is 167,901. An estimated 58.6 percent of households in Morris own their homes, with an average family size of 3.14. The median household income in Morris is 50,779, with22.5 percentage of households earning at least $100,000 annually. For working parents and professionals who are searching for cheap homes in Morris, the median commute time of resident workers (in minutes) is 9.5. The median age of residents in Morris is 31.4, split between 46 percent male versus 54 female. The percentage of residents who report being married in Morris is 43.9, with an average family size of 3.14.

The percentage of residents who report their race in Morris is as follows:

White 87.7%
Black / African American 3.4%
Asian 2.9%
American Indian / Alaskan Native 2.1%
Native Hawaiian / Other Pacifc Islander 0.3%
Multi-racial 1.1%
Other 2.6%
